Agatha Christie’s The Mirror Crack’d is a mystery rooted in glamour, tragedy, and revenge. Here are five fascinating facts that even die-hard Christie fans may not know!

1. A Real Hollywood Tragedy Inspired it
Christie drew inspiration from a heartbreaking true story involving actress Gene Tierney. After contracting rubella during pregnancy, Tierney gave birth to a child with severe disabilities. This deeply personal trauma is mirrored in the fictional past of Marina Gregg.

2. Miss Marple Faces One of Her Most Emotional Cases
The Mirror Crack’d explores aging, loneliness, and regret through the lens of Miss Marple herself. The detective isn’t just solving a crime. She’s grappling with her own sense of relevance and place in a changing world.

3. It Was One of the Last Marple Novels Christie Wrote
Published in 1962, the novel came late in Christie’s career. Many readers noted its darker tone and modern themes, which reflected the era’s cultural shifts and Christie’s own evolving worldview.

4. It’s Been Adapted into a Star-Studded Movie
The 1980 film adaptation starred Elizabeth Taylor as Marina Gregg and Angela Lansbury as Miss Marple. The film also starred Tony Curtis, Rock Hudson, Kim Novak, and Geraldine Chaplin.

5. It’s a Story About Stories
The Mirror Crack’d examines the fictions people create to cope with their past. In this way, the cracking of the mirror is not simply literal; it also symbolizes the fracturing of each character’s truth.
